The Legion of Super-Heroes of the 31st century traveled back to the early 21st century to try to find Superman for help of against powerful group of super-villains in their era. Unfortunately, they traveled too far back and instead finding a young Clark Kent who haven't assume his Superman identity yet. Taking him back to their future, Clark embracing his destiny and helps the Legion in fighting evil like Emerald Empress and upholding the laws of the United Planets before he can return to his own time. A new beginning for the Legions on the second season of the show. With Clark returns to the 21st century and began his role as the Man of Steel, The Legions realizes that they still need Superman within their rank. Enter a mysterious Kryptonian from the 41st century, appears to the be the clone of Superman, arrives to the 31st century to aid the Legions.
The adventures of a young Clark Kent, as Superman, during his time with a team of teenage superheroes in the far future.

This is due to a legal dispute between DC Comics and the heirs of Superman co-creator Jerome Siegel over the ownership of the name "Superboy". Legion of Super Heroes - Volume 1 is a four-episode DVD, released on August 28, 2007. The disc contains the first four episodes of the show.

Legion of Super Heroes - Volume 2 was released on February 5, 2008. The single, Region 1 disc has episodes 5 through 8 of the series. No. Legion of Super Heroes producer James Tucker dispelled this myth in an interview posted at The World's Finest: "The Legion series was never tied to the Justice League Unlimited episode ("Far From Home"). Supergirl was never, ever going to be in the Legion. The true origin of the series came out of Cartoon Network's desire to have a Superman-centric series to premiere when the movie Superman Returns premiered. Superman as part of the Legion worked for them. So the series was originally developed for Cartoon Network, then they passed and Kids WB! stepped in. They, too, wanted a Superman-centric series with Superman fresh out of Smallville, learning to be Superman. That's the reality."
